Every photo, drawing and document you upload counts towards your workspace's storage allowance. Here's how the allowance works and how to add more room when you need it.
BuilderDash keeps a running total of how much space your files are using and shows it against what your plan includes. When you're close to the limit, you'll see a warning, and when you need more room, you can add extra storage in a couple of clicks.
Every account comes with 10 GB of storage included as standard. Each file you upload - photos, drawings, documents - adds its own size to your running total the moment it's saved, and deleting a file removes its size again. The total is the combined size of all your files across every job in your workspace.
To keep the figure accurate over time, BuilderDash also does a full recount every night, adding up the true size of all your files and correcting the running total if it's drifted.

Only the workspace owner can buy, change or remove storage, and you'll need an active subscription with a payment card on file before you can add it.
